This invention relates to improvements inv pyrophoric lighters and has particular reference to a fuel reservoir and mounting therefor.
. In various types of lighters now in general use. the reservoir, with its ignitable wick, is xed within the casing of the lighter and, as a consetending from the upper end of the fuel reservoir I5, when the closure II visin closing position. The reservoir il is provided in its bottom with a customary fuell inlet' Il, and, in accordance quence, when the wick is ignited and the lighter at least partially inverted, as must be done when lattempting to light a smoking pipe, the iiame from the wick' will impinge upon some portion of the lighter casing and, aside from the carbon deposit thimjormed on the casing, will sometimes heat the casing to suchl an extent, before the light can be obtained, that the lighter cannot be conveniently held in the hand without possible injury.
'I'he present invention is designed to overcome the above difliculty by providing a simple and practical construction wherein theffuel reservoir is movably mounted within the casing of the lighter in such manner that said reservoir may be adjusted from-a position in which it is enclosed within said casing to one wherein the wick of :the reservoir is projected outwardly beyond said casing, thus making it convenient to tilt the lighter to obtain a light for a smoking pipe 4without injurious effect.

Cooperating 'with lthe stop member 26 and adapted to contact the same when 5 e the reservoir has reached the limit of its outward movement, is a pin 21 extending from the reservoir adjacent the bottom thereof. When the reservoir is slid outwardly s'aid pin 21 contacts the stop 26, as best shown in Figure 2. Due to l the inclination of the tube 2l, the pin 21 assumes v a partially offset positiongrelative to the stop 2l, as shown in the dotted line position of Figure 2. 'I'his is donefor the purpose of permitting the pin 21 to be shifted laterally with respect to the stop 16 26 to entirely clear said stop and thus enable the reservoir I 5 to be completely withdrawn from the casing when it is desired to replenish the fuel supply. Such lateral shifting of the pin 21 is made possible by reducing the width of the reservoir I5 to slightly less than the interior width of the casing I0, as shown in Figure 3. so as to give the reservoir, in its partially projected position, sufficient play within the casing I0 to enable the pin 21 to be cleared of the stop 28, after which 25 the reservoir can be completely extracted from the casing.
In the form of the invention shown in Figures 5 and 6, the operating means for the closure Ii and the igniting means forthe wick are of the same construction as previously described and the casing is likewise the saxne with the exception that in the present embodiment the front wall thereof is providedwith an elongated slot 23.
Projecting through this slot is the headed closure member 29 for thefuel inlet n ofthe reservoir Il,
said inlet being formed in the front wall of the reservoir instead of in the bottom thereof as in the first described embodiment. With this arrangement, the closure or plug 29 acts as a stop which engages the upper end of the slot 28 to i limit the outward movement of the reservoir to the dotted 'line position when the lighter-'1s tilted.
